Embracing Modernity in Qipao Fashion Shows:The New Wave of Elegance

The word 'Qipao' refers to a traditional Chinese women's garment, originating from the Manchu era. It embodies a rich cultural heritage, symbolizing elegance and grace. Over the years, Qipao has evolved as a fashion icon, adapting to different styles and trends. In modern fashion shows, Qipao takes center stage, showcasing its timeless charm while incorporating contemporary designs and elements.

The new wave of Qipao fashion showcases a fusion of traditional craftsmanship with modern aesthetics. Designers experiment with different materials, colors, and patterns, while preserving the essence of the original Qipao. The use of innovative fabrics like silk, velvet, and even modern synthetic materials give these cheongsam a contemporary feel. The intricate details and patterns are often influenced by modern fashion trends, resulting in designs that are both traditional and modern.

One of the most significant changes in modern Qipao fashion shows is the emphasis on body positivity. Traditional Qipao often emphasized a certain body shape, but modern designs are more inclusive, catering to different body types. This shift reflects a broader cultural shift towards accepting and celebrating diverse body shapes in fashion.

Moreover, modern Qipao fashion shows are not just about the clothing; they are also about the presentation. The use of technology, music, and lighting enhances the overall experience. The shows are more immersive and interactive, allowing viewers to appreciate the craftsmanship and design elements better.

The new breed of Qipao designers is also using their platforms to promote cultural awareness. They are incorporating elements of Chinese culture into their designs, educating viewers about the rich heritage behind the Qipao. This helps to promote cross-cultural understanding and appreciation for traditional Chinese culture.

In addition to being worn for special occasions like weddings and festivals, modern Qipao is also becoming a part of everyday fashion. Designers are creating more casual versions that can be worn for everyday activities, making it easier for people to embrace this traditional garment as part of their everyday wardrobe.
